The show of all shows, Soca Monarch, was held at Carnival City, Victoria Park, last evening, and saw a record breaking crowd turning out to see twenty of St. Vincent's top Soca artists compete for the title of Soca Monarch. The nineteen artists performed their best and most managed to move, shake and lift the crowd but only one was able to dethrone the then reighning Soca Monarch. However, there was only one person who could've put Fireman Hooper in his place, and that's meh boi Skinny!!!!!!!!!!!!(He sang "Meh head bad") Congrats man.....Second was Fireman Hooper with "hu e hut e hut", third was meh other boi Problem Child with "For life", fourth was Icon with "2knee" (he needs to move up the ladder man..buh then again where else would he go??), and rounding up the top 5 is Demus with his song "We going crazy"
Congrats to all the finalists once more. Skinny Fabulous automatically goes on to represent St. Vincent and the Grenadines in the Regional Soca Monarch in Trinidad and Tobago. The prize for the winner of that show is TT$1,000,000.00 (which is half that amount in ECD$)
